Web7 de jul. de 2024 · West Nile virus is most commonly spread to people by the bite of an infected mosquito. Mosquitoes become infected when they feed on infected birds. Infected mosquitoes then spread West Nile virus … Web4 de mar. de 2004 · Key facts Eight in 10 people who become infected with WNV show no symptoms. About 20% of infected people develop moderate symptoms, including fever, headache, fatigue, and body aches, nausea, rash, and swollen glands. In about 1 in 150 cases, WNV causes severe disease that can lead to encephalitis, meningitis, paralysis, …
